Abstract
The present invention discloses an electronic remote control anti-theft lock which comprises a circuit device and a mechanical device, wherein the circuit device comprises a remote controller and a computer controller; the mechanical device comprises a first electronic lock, a cipher lock and a door lock. The first electronic lock comprises a casing, a motor is fixedly arranged in the casing, a gear is fixed on the end part of a rotary shaft of the motor, and the motor is electrically connected with the computer controller; a pushing and pulling rod is arranged in the casing, and a saw tooth which is meshed with the gear is arranged on the pushing and pulling rod. The cipher lock comprises a drive plate, a rotary shaft and a cipher piece which is provided with a clamping groove; the rotary shaft is provided with a hole which can be used for containing the pushing and pulling rod to enter and remove. The door lock comprises a lock body and a lock latch; a connecting piece is fixedly arranged on a rotary shaft of the lock body. A structural form of mutual linkage of three locksets of the electronic lock, the cipher lock and the door lock is adopted, the safety is strong, and the anti-theft effect is good; the device can lie in a closed state at mean time through the arrangement of a power switch, the electric energy can be saved, and simultaneously, the service life of the device can also be prolonged.
Description
Technical field
The present invention relates to a kind of theftproof lock, specifically, relate to a kind of electronic remote control anti-theft lock.
Background technology
Theftproof lock generally has mechanical lock and electronic lock dual mode, confidentiality, the anti-theft effect of mechanical lock are poor, the management of standard machinery lock key is also relatively more difficult, and at present, the anti-theft feature of electronic safety lock is more single on the market, confidentiality, anti-theft effect are undesirable, internal electric equipment is under the "on" position always, and electric components wherein such as electromagnet damage easily owing to switch on for a long time, so that the frequent replacing of having to, increased user's burden, stability is poor.
Summary of the invention
The electronic remote control anti-theft lock that the purpose of this invention is to provide a kind of strong security, good anti-theft effect.
For achieving the above object, the technical solution adopted in the present invention is: electronic remote control anti-theft lock, comprise circuit arrangement and mechanical device, described circuit arrangement comprises remote controller, computer controller, mechanical device comprises first electronic lock that is installed on the security door, coded lock, door lock, it is characterized in that: described first electronic lock comprises housing, be set with motor in the described housing, the end of described machine shaft is fixed with gear, described motor is electrically connected with computer controller, be provided with pull bar in the described housing, has the sawtooth that is meshed with gear on the described pull bar, described coded lock comprises dial, rotating shaft, cipher chips with draw-in groove, described rotating shaft are provided with the hole that holds the pull bar turnover, and described hole is used to hold the pull bar turnover, described door lock comprises lock body, lock bolt, be set with in flakes in the rotating shaft of described lock body, described end in flakes is provided with dead bolt, and described draw-in groove holds the turnover of dead bolt.
Below be the improvement of such scheme: described mechanical device is provided with second electronic lock that is installed on the security door, described second electronic lock comprises housing, be set with motor in the described housing, the end of described machine shaft is fixed with gear, described motor is electrically connected with computer controller, be provided with pull bar in the described housing, have the sawtooth that is meshed with gear on the described pull bar.
Described computer controller is provided with power switch.
Described power switch is a push-button switch.
Beneficial effect: the present invention adopts said structure, adopt electronic lock, coded lock, three kinds of locksets of door lock chain form of structure mutually, confidentiality is stronger, anti-theft effect is better, the setting of power switch, can make equipment be in closed condition at ordinary times, save electric energy, also prolonged the application life of equipment simultaneously.

The specific embodiment
As shown in Figure 1, electronic remote control anti-theft lock, comprise circuit arrangement and mechanical device, comprise the computer controller 5 that is installed on the security door 2 and first electronic lock 6, second electronic lock 7, coded lock 8, door lock 9, power switch 11, power switch 11 is a push-button switch, and casing 1 is provided with lockhole 4,41,42, and the outside of security door 2 is equipped with protective door 3, the pull bar 74 of second electronic lock 7 is suitable with lockhole 41, and the bolt 12 of door lock 9 is suitable with lockhole 4.
As shown in Figure 2, described second electronic lock 7 comprises housing 71, be set with motor 72 in the described housing 71, the end of described motor 72 rotating shafts is fixed with gear 73, described motor 72 is electrically connected with computer controller 5, be provided with pull bar 74 in the described housing 71, has the sawtooth 75 that is meshed with gear 73 on the described pull bar 74, as shown in Figure 3, described coded lock 8 comprises dial 81, rotating shaft 82, cipher chips 83 with draw-in groove 84, described rotating shaft 82 is provided with the hole 10 that can hold pull bar 15 turnover, as shown in Figure 4, described door lock 9 comprises lock body 91, lock bolt 12 is set with in flakes 13 in the rotating shaft of described lock body 91, described 13 end in flakes is provided with dead bolt 14.
Described first electronic lock 6 comprises housing 61, be set with motor 16 in the described housing 61, the end of described motor 16 rotating shafts is fixed with gear 17, described motor 16 is electrically connected with computer controller 5, be provided with pull bar 15 in the described housing 61, has the sawtooth 18 that is meshed with gear 17 on the described pull bar 15, with the computer controller 5 and first electronic lock 6, second electronic lock 7, coded lock 8, door lock 9 is installed in the protective housing 31 of security door 2 inboards, push button power switch 11 is installed in the outside of security door 2, contact with protective door 3, the pull bar 74 of second electronic lock 7 matches with lockhole 41, the lock bolt 12 of door lock 9 matches with lockhole 4, door lock on the protective door 3 matches with lockhole 42, be in closed condition as shown in Figure 5 at ordinary times, the pull bar 15 of first electronic lock 6 is positioned at the hole 10 of rotating shaft 82 on the coded lock 8, on the door lock 9 in flakes 13 dead bolt 14 be positioned at outside the draw-in groove 84, the lock bolt 12 of door lock 9 is positioned at lockhole 4, during unlatching, earlier protective door 3 is opened, push button power switch 11 is released, power connection, computer controller 5 must be established beginning work by cable, press remote controller, the motor 72 of computer controller 5 controls second electronic lock 7 rotates, the pull bar 74 of second electronic lock 7 withdraws from lockhole 41, simultaneously, the motor 16 of first electronic lock 6 rotates, and the pull bar 15 of first electronic lock 6 withdraws from hole 10, locks 8 dial 81 again according to the password rotational password, make draw-in groove 84 alignment on the cipher chips 83, rotate door lock 9 again, the dead bolt 14 on 13 enters in the draw-in groove 84 in flakes, and lock bolt 12 withdraws from from lockhole 4, just be in opening as shown in Figure 6, after closing, when closing protective door 3 at last, because of protective door 3 touches push button power switch 11 with power-off.
